Framework definitions
- §1
- a dose of medicine in the form of a small pellet
- §2
- something that resembles a tablet of medicine in shape or size
- §3
- a contraceptive in the form of a pill containing estrogen and progestin to inhibit ovulation and so prevent conception
- §4
- something unpleasant or offensive that must be tolerated or endured
- §5
- a unpleasant or tiresome person
